As the pioneers of the AFL, The Melbourne Football Club holds a special place in history. Our legacy dates back 167 years, when we wrote the rules of the game. We became the inaugural VFA/VFL/AFL Club and still carry the distinction of being the oldest professional sporting club in the world. ABOUT THE ROLE
The Club is seeking to appoint a VFLW Assistant Coach for the Casey Demons Football Club. This is an exciting opportunity to assist our Senior Coach in developing and implementing training programs that improve individual player skills, team dynamics, and overall game strategy.
This role will be commencing in February 2026.
KEY AREAS OF RESPONSIBILITY
Reporting directly to the VFLW Senior Coach, the key areas of responsibilities will include:
- Support the Senior Coach in developing and implementing the VFLW Football Program, including game plans, training sessions and match strategies.
- Conduct individual and team skill development sessions, and provide feedback to players on their performance.
- Assist in game day presentation and support the Senior Coaching during matches
- Contribute to the development of team culture, values and standards
- Collaborate with other coaches, support staff, and players to create a positive and high-performance environment.
- Analyse and review game footage to provide feedback to players and coaches in review and preview sessions for their allocated Line.
- Provide input into player recruitment and talent identification
- Actively participate in coach education and development opportunities
